Deregistration and reimbursement of tuition fees

Students may terminate their student registration at any point during the academic year. It is important to take care of deregistration as soon as you discontinue your studies.

Reimbursement of tuition fees

It is in your interest to apply for deregistration on time and in line with regulations as late deregistration may affect the amount refunded. 
Upon termination of your student registration, tuition fees are refunded for each remaining month of the academic year. Students who have paid a reduced tuition fee because they were enrolled in more than one programme will only receive a refund if they terminate enrolment in all programmes.
Deregistration per 1 July and 1 August? No refund can be made.

NOTE: From the date when your registration is terminated, you are no longer entitled to a study grant or an OV card (public transport pass). Make sure that you have ended your "studiefinanciering" from DUO before or on the date that your enrolment as a student has ended.

Termination and changes of student registration

Termination of registration should be done via Studielink (except in cases mentioned below). Please log in under 'My enrolments' and go to 'Application for termination of enrolment'. Note that you must also do this if you have completed your Bachelors/Masters programme and will not continue studying.

Changes of registration should also be done via Studielink (except in cases mentioned below).
